| package jdk.vm.ci.hotspot; |
| |
| import jdk.vm.ci.runtime.JVMCICompilerFactory; |
| |
| /** |
| * HotSpot extensions to {@link JVMCICompilerFactory}. |
| */ |
| public abstract class HotSpotJVMCICompilerFactory implements JVMCICompilerFactory { |
| |
| /** |
| * Gets 0 or more prefixes identifying classes that should by compiled by C1 in simple mode |
| * (i.e., {@code CompLevel_simple}) when HotSpot is running with tiered compilation. The |
| * prefixes should be class or package names using "/" as the separator, e.g. "jdk/vm/ci". |
| * |
| * @return 0 or more Strings identifying packages that should by compiled by the first tier only |
| * or null if no redirection to C1 should be performed. |
| */ |
| public String[] getTrivialPrefixes() { |
| return null; |
| } |
| |
| public enum CompilationLevelAdjustment { |
| /** |
| * No adjustment. |
| */ |
| None, |
| |
| /** |
| * Adjust based on declaring class of method. |
| */ |
| ByHolder, |
| |
| /** |
| * Adjust based on declaring class, name and signature of method. |
| */ |
| ByFullSignature |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Determines if this object may want to adjust the compilation level for a method that is being |
| * scheduled by the VM for compilation. |
| */ |
| public CompilationLevelAdjustment getCompilationLevelAdjustment() { |
| return CompilationLevelAdjustment.None; |
| } |
| |
| public enum CompilationLevel { |
| None, |
| Simple, |
| LimitedProfile, |
| FullProfile, |
| FullOptimization |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Potentially modifies the compilation level currently selected by the VM compilation policy |
| * for a method. |
| * |
| * @param declaringClass the class in which the method is declared |
| * @param name the name of the method or {@code null} depending on the value that was returned |
| * by {@link #getCompilationLevelAdjustment()} |
| * @param signature the signature of the method or {@code null} depending on the value that was |
| * returned by {@link #getCompilationLevelAdjustment()} |
| * @param isOsr specifies if the compilation being scheduled in an OSR compilation |
| * @param level the compilation level currently selected by the VM compilation policy |
| * @return the compilation level to use for the compilation being scheduled (must be a valid |
| * {@code CompLevel} enum value) |
| */ |
| public CompilationLevel adjustCompilationLevel(Class<?> declaringClass, String name, String signature, boolean isOsr, CompilationLevel level) { |
| throw new InternalError("Should not reach here"); |
| } |
| } |
